Chesterfield residents have just a few days left to ensure their experiences of local health services are considered as part of Toby Perkins MP’s Summer Health survey.

Over the summer holidays, Toby and his campaign team have been conducting doorstep, online and written surveys into local NHS services. The results will inform local health bosses, parliamentary questions and be fed in to Labour’s health policy reviews, but constituents only have until the end of the month to add their views.

Toby said, “Hopefully, almost every household in Chesterfield will have either had someone knock on their door to go through the survey questions, or received a paper copy through their letterbox. It is vital that I hear the views of as many of my constituents as possible so that I have a wide and varied account of local experiences with NHS services. There is still time to return the survey, or complete it online, and I hope people will take a few minutes to give me their views.”
